Klaus-Dieter ThobenDivision IKAPApplied Information and CommunicationTechnology for ProductionHighly productive co-operationsbetween independent companieswith the aim to develop and realizecustomized products are an importantsuccess factor for the competitivenessof the European industry.Due to immense political changesand the emergence of global markets,new ways of co-operations, socalled enterprise networks, can beseen in addition to traditional supplychains. These enterprise networks areoften established to realize a singlecustomers order and thus play animportant role during the conceptualphase (product design) as well asduring the realization phase (production).The research unit IKAP designs,develops and realizes methods andtools to support co-operative, interorganizationalenterprise networks. Itsresearch concentrates on efficientand effective collaborative designand production processes byapplying innovative information andcommunication technologies (ICT).As focus can be seen the collaborativeinteractions of enterprises duringdistributed design and productionprocesses as well as during the lateprocesses of the product life cyclesuch as the usage phase or therecycling phase. The research resultsare integrated in the academic educationof next generation engineers(mechanical engineering, industrialmanagement, systems engineering)at the University of <strong>Bremen</strong>. Anotherapplication field of research results isin industrial projects where innovativeapproaches are transferred to practicalproblems.The research unit BIBA-IKAP is dividedinto two departments:Collaborative Business inEnterprise NetworksThe department Collaborative Businessin Enterprise Networks developsand implements concepts in theareas of Cooperative Process Managementand Network Life CycleManagement in networked organizations.Thereby classical products aswell as services can be regarded assubjects of cooperation in enterprisenetworks.The thematic priorities of the departmentare Cooperative OrganizationStructures as well as CooperativeInnovation, Risk and Quality Managementin enterprise networks. Theapplication of Gaming-approachesfor competence intermediationand sensitization plus the ExtendedProduct as subject of cooperationin enterprise networks are representativeof the central concepts in thescope of the research work.The department is working methodicallywith following approaches:Cooperative Process ManagementIn this subject field, methods forevaluating processes, for the analysisof requirements while building upnew structures, as well as for thespecification of IT-tools and managementconcepts are used. The goalis generally the prototypical realizationof developed solutions. Corecompetencies are thereby methodsand tools of performance measurementin enterprise networks for theevaluation of distributed businessprocesses, methods and tools forenabling cooperative innovationprocesses in networks and methodsand tools for inter-organizational riskand quality management. In thiscontext, Gaming-approaches as wellare used in order to sensitize professionalswith respect to novel questionsof networked acting or to impartcompetences of concrete topics tothem by playing.Network Life Cycle ManagementThis subject field deals with the lifecycle of a network from its formation,over the operation phase and evolution,until the cooperation is dissolved.Methods to support the formationof networks as well as the operationand dissolution are researched andapplied along the life cycle. The aimespecially is to accelerate the preparednessof networks for initiating ashort-term cooperation by means ofadequate concepts and tools.Intelligent ICT for co-operativeproductionThe department “Intelligent ICT forco-operative production” deals withthe application of the latest IC-technologiesto develop and implementco-operative networks. In this context,acquisition, provision and transformationof process and productrelated information is considered. Thisinformation is used to integrate realproducts with their digital representation,the product avatar, along thewhole product life cycle.By combining the latest communicationtechnologies of the 3rd and4th generation with the latest positioningtechnologies (e.g. Galileo),new context and customer specificservices can be realized along theentire product life cycle. These servicescan improve the competitivenessof today‘s enterprises.
